There's no place like home for Wapato, who bounced back after a  loss on the road  last Saturday. They took down the Naches Valley Rangers 68-53  on Friday. Given the Wolves' advantage  in MaxPreps' Washington basketball rankings  (they are ranked 52nd, while the Rangers are ranked 285th), the result  wasn't entirely unexpected.

Wapato pushed their record up to 8-3 with the  victory, which was their seventh straight  at home dating back to last season. The wins came thanks to their offensive performance across that stretch, as  they  averaged 71.4 points per game. As for Naches Valley,  they are  on  a  nine-game losing streak  that has dropped them down to 2-9.
 Wapato won't have much time to rest: their next  game is against Zillah  at 5:15  p.m.  on Saturday. Zillah knows how to get  points on the board -- the  team has finished with 55 points or more in their past 11 matches -- so hopefully Wapato likes a good challenge. As for Naches Valley, they will be playing at home against College Place  at 7:15  p.m.  on Tuesday.
